Output 19d905f15d93b08bf6df78d90eef6636e8d8f0ff2a84e94c6a61b0bda76139e8:0

value
161400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af1e545b786d346f508906350503e018319635 OP_EQUAL
address
3ELJxTi1UY7Vbz9LyAWSmYH3DnKBJUAbXC
transaction
19d905f15d93b08bf6df78d90eef6636e8d8f0ff2a84e94c6a61b0bda76139e8
confirmations
338383
spent
true